Top compact cars for the Canaries

In terms of compact cars, when choosing the best car to drive on the islands, you should consider its reliability and comfort, and a good compact car for the Canary Islands should be suitable for driving in local conditions.

Honda Fit is known for its wonderful reliability and fuel efficiency, but its interior space, compatible with a bigger roomier car, cannot but amaze. It is an outstanding option for moving around the city and short journeys across the islands.

The Toyota Yaris is a very reasonably priced car that has long-term reliability. With its fuel efficiency and small size, it is a perfect choice for use on island roads.

The Ford Fiesta has been famous for the high quality of its driving and strong build, and it is a very easy car to drive along the twisty mountainous roads of the Canaries. It is also equipped with advanced gadgets for a simple and pleasant trip.

Volkswagen’s Polo is one of the most fashionable small cars in the market, and it is known for its high-quality driving, comfort and superior build quality. Moreover, it is a very reliable automobile.

The Hyundai i10 is a much more affordable choice to drive around the islands. It is also very small, easy to park, and convenient for the islands’ streets, and comes with a long warranty.

Maintenance Tips for Small Cars running in the Canaries

Keeping your small car in top condition while driving through island roads is no mean achievement. The salty nature of the air outside causes rusting in cars more often than the dry-framed vehicles. Some rough terrains also take a toll on engines and brakes. Lastly, the hilly nature can put unnecessary pressure on the braking system.

Washing your car to remove the salt residue more often and focusing on the underneath is the first maintenance tip. Then keeping the engine oil, brake fluid, and coolant at the right levels to let the car cope with the varied terrain is essential.

Regularly check the tyre pressures to ensure they are properly inflated, which guarantees better mileage and safer handling on windy roads. Brake pads wear out more often because of the hilly terrains so periodical checking is vital to ensure your safety, more so if you are using the hilly roads on a more regular basis.
